Abbas:
The Abbas was 298 GRT gunboat of the Egyptian Coast Guard during WWI. Based out of Sollum, the ship was attacked and sunk on 05 November 1915 by the German U-Boat U-35 (Waldemar Kophamel). Another Egyptian gunboat was also damaged in the attack, the Nour el-Bahr, but survived the attack.

Some sources state that the ship was sunk off of Sollum, while others state that the ship was sunk while anchored.

The U-35 (a Type U-31 U-Boat) was considered one of the most successful U-Boats of WWI with 236 ships to its credit. Previously on the same day, the U-35 had attacked and sank the HMS Tara and towed the lifeboats and survivors ashore at Bardia.
